WebApr 12, 2024 · The life cycle assessment methodology (LCA) is an environmental impact measurement technique, often a part of sustainability consulting services, that considers a product's lifespan, from manufacture to disposal. It encompasses factors such as energy use, emissions and waste output, and depletion of natural resources.
